2. Cloud DVR Storage

The digital video recorder functionality within Sling TV relies fundamentally on cloud-based storage. This system allows users to save television programs and movies to remote servers, accessible through an internet connection. The available capacity and the management thereof are critical components in effectively capturing content.

  • Storage Allocation and Limits

    Sling TV allocates a finite amount of cloud storage to each user account, typically determined by the subscription package. This quota dictates the maximum number of hours of programming that can be saved. For instance, a base subscription might include 50 hours of storage, while a premium package could offer 200 hours or more. Exceeding this limit requires either upgrading the subscription or deleting existing recordings.

  • Content Retention Policies

    Saved content is not stored indefinitely. Sling TV enforces retention policies, automatically deleting recordings after a specified period. This period varies but commonly ranges from 30 to 90 days. Awareness of these policies is essential to avoid unintended loss of saved programs. For example, a user who records a series finale may need to watch it promptly to prevent its automatic deletion.

  • Accessibility Across Devices

    Cloud DVR storage provides the advantage of accessing recordings from multiple devices. Users can initiate a recording on a television in one location and subsequently watch it on a tablet or smartphone in another location, provided both devices are linked to the same Sling TV account and have an active internet connection. This flexibility enhances the overall viewing experience.

  • Impact of Internet Bandwidth

    Both recording and playback of content stored in the cloud DVR are dependent on the quality and speed of the user’s internet connection. Insufficient bandwidth can lead to buffering, reduced video quality, or even recording failures. Optimal performance requires a stable and reliable internet connection that meets Sling TV’s recommended specifications.

3. Recording Schedules

The establishment of recording schedules forms a core element of content capture functionality. The capacity to pre-program recordings automates content preservation, streamlining the user experience and ensuring access to preferred programming.

  • Series Recording

    The ‘series recording’ function facilitates the automatic capture of all episodes within a television series. The user designates a specific show, and the system records all subsequent episodes as they air, eliminating the need for manual recording setup for each individual program. This feature becomes particularly beneficial for programs with irregular broadcast schedules, ensuring that episodes are not missed.

  • Single Event Recording

    The recording of singular events, such as sporting competitions or special presentations, involves setting a precise start and end time for the recording. This is typically accomplished via the program guide, where the user selects the desired event and schedules the recording. The accuracy of program guide data directly affects the success of single event recordings. Unexpected broadcast delays or extensions can lead to incomplete or truncated recordings.

  • Conflict Resolution

    Scheduling conflicts arise when multiple programs are set to record simultaneously, exceeding the platform’s recording capacity. Systems typically implement conflict resolution protocols, prioritizing recordings based on user preferences or scheduling order. Users may receive notifications of potential conflicts and be required to manually adjust recording schedules to ensure the capture of the most important content.

  • Manual Time Entry

    In cases where program guide information is incomplete or unavailable, manual time entry allows users to define recording start and end times directly. This method requires a precise understanding of the program schedule and can be more prone to errors than guide-based scheduling. It is commonly used for recording programs broadcast on local channels or during off-peak hours where guide data may be less reliable.

9. Legal Limitations

The act of capturing and storing content via streaming services is subject to legal constraints that users must observe. These regulations are not always explicitly stated within the service’s interface, yet they govern the permissible uses of recorded material.

  • Copyright Infringement

    Unauthorized reproduction and distribution of copyrighted material constitute a violation of federal law. Recording television programs or movies for personal use may be permissible under fair use doctrines, but distributing those recordings, even without monetary gain, infringes upon copyright holders’ rights. For example, sharing a recorded sporting event with friends online without authorization is illegal, as it bypasses legitimate distribution channels and revenue streams.

  • Terms of Service Agreements

    Streaming services establish legally binding terms of service agreements that users must accept to access their platforms. These agreements often contain clauses restricting the user’s ability to record, distribute, or modify content. Violating these terms, even if the actions are not directly prohibited by copyright law, can lead to account suspension or legal action. For instance, Sling’s terms may limit the number of times a particular recording can be accessed, effectively prohibiting large-scale sharing.

  • Digital Rights Management (DRM)

    Content providers employ DRM technologies to prevent unauthorized access, copying, or distribution of their material. These technologies can restrict the ability to record content, limit the number of devices on which recordings can be played, or even prevent playback altogether. Attempts to circumvent DRM measures are generally illegal under the Digital Millennium Copyright Act (DMCA). For example, software designed to remove DRM from Sling recordings would likely be illegal to create or distribute.

  • Geographic Restrictions

    Content licensing agreements often restrict the distribution of material to specific geographic regions. Recording content in one country and then accessing it in another may violate these agreements. Streaming services typically implement geo-blocking technologies to prevent users from circumventing these restrictions, and attempting to bypass these measures may constitute a violation of the service’s terms of use. An example of this might be recording a locally broadcast program while traveling internationally, which could be prohibited.

Frequently Asked Questions About Capturing Content

The following addresses prevalent inquiries concerning the process of saving content on the Sling platform, focusing on practical applications and potential limitations.

Question 1: How is recording capacity determined?

Recording capacity is typically dictated by the subscription package selected. The specific storage allocation, measured in hours, varies according to the subscription tier. Higher-tier subscriptions generally offer more storage.

Question 2: What occurs when storage capacity is reached?

Once the allocated storage space is exhausted, new recordings will not be possible until existing content is deleted to free up space. The system may provide notifications regarding imminent storage limitations.

Question 3: Are there restrictions on the type of content that can be recorded?

Certain programs or channels may be unavailable for recording due to licensing agreements or other contractual obligations. The system typically indicates when content cannot be recorded.

Question 4: How long does recorded content remain available?

Recorded content is subject to expiration policies. The duration for which content remains accessible varies depending on the program and applicable licensing agreements. Content is automatically deleted after the expiration period.

Question 5: Can recordings be accessed from multiple devices?

Recordings are generally accessible from multiple devices associated with the same account, provided the devices meet compatibility requirements and have an active internet connection.

Question 6: What steps can be taken to troubleshoot recording failures?

Recording failures may be attributed to various factors, including network connectivity issues, insufficient storage space, or device incompatibility. Verify network stability, ensure adequate storage, and confirm device compatibility to mitigate potential failures.
